Ondo 2020: Thugs disrupt rally as Thousands Dump APC for ZLP in Akoko

A rally meant to receive over One thousand five hundred members of the Ruling All Progressives Congress (APC) into the Zenith Labour Party (ZLP) was on Sunday disrupted by thugs reportedly loyal to a sitting commissioner in Akungba Akoko township of Akoko southwest local government in Ondo state.

The Public meeting was held in preparation for the October 10 Governorship election in the state.

It was gathered that People scampered for safety after the street urchins invaded the United Primary School, Akungba, where the event was holding.

The public address system hired to provide sound system were reportedly destroyed by the thugs, while people were chased out of the venue with dangerous weapons.

Hon. Abiodun Ogunbi, a former member of the Ondo State House of Assembly said they were thugs sponsored by the ruling APC to disrupt the programme.

Ogunbi said his life was also threatened by the thugs who were sent by the chieftain of the APC.

Some members of the ZLP, it was gathered, sustained varying degrees of injuries at the event.

The Ondo state Police PRO, Mr. Tee-leo Ikoro, while reacting to the development on a phone chat with Nigerian cable news online said he is yet to receive any report on the violent attack.

He however reiterated the resolve of the force to provide security and aide Peaceful Political gatherings in the state.

The APC spokesperson in the affected local government, Mr. Otete, while responding to questions from Nigerian Cable news online over the incident said: “I’m not even aware of that”.
